U.S.-Canada Tire Price Gap Closing, Legislation Still Pending

CBC News reported recently that some Canadian tire retailers have been dropping tire prices, effectively closing the gap on U.S. retailers and helping keep Canadian tire buyers home. The Canada-U.S. tire price gap, long a headache for Canadian retailers thanks to a lack of legislative support by their government, has tightened in recent months, and

Ferrari Appointed Head of Pirelli Latin America; New North American CEO Named

Effective Jan. 1, Paolo Ferrari, current chairman and CEO of Pirelli Tire North America, will serve as CEO of Pirelli’s Latin America region. He will be replaced by Pierluigi Dinelli. Conti C.V. Names New Aftermarket Head

Continental Commercial Vehicles & Aftermarket has promoted Howard Laster to the head of the NAFTA aftermarket. In his new role with the company, Laster is responsible for overall business strategy, product quality and performance, as well as development of effective sales and marketing activities in North America for the Continental and VDO brand. Pirelli 2013 Sales Increase But Profits Flat

Pirelli & C. SpA today reported full-year 2013 consolidated revenues of 6,146.2 million euros on Dec. 31, an increase of 1.2% from 6,071.5 million euros a year earlier. Conti Expects Minor Tire Market Growth

This year, Continental expects to sell a total of 11 million more tires in the European and the NAFTA replacement markets than in 2013.
